We, my brother and me went to several divisional races, before we even thought about a car or class. Talk to the SS racers believe me they will all talk to you ,and give you any advice you ask. Lot a nice people out there, no one refused to talk. We got a lot of answers, and all pretty much accurate.
But it is a steep learning curve, after buying a stocker we have still yet to attend a divisional race. Lots of test and tune to get familiar with the car. Learning what the car wants and needs, and how to adjust is crucial. Testing and tuning at your local track is way cheaper than at a divisional race.
This forum has got a lot of knowledge, just sift through the cynicism. There are a lot of veterans on this site who get tired of the bull with the sanctioning bodies and like to vent.
